Joseph RaffaelAmerican, b. 1933

Joseph Raffael (born February 22, 1933 in Brooklyn, NY) is an American contemporary realist painter.

His paintings are almost all presented on a very large scale. Most of his paintings are watercolors.

EDUCATION

1953-54 Attended Cooper Union, New York

1954 Summer Fellowship Yale-Norfolk School

1954-56 Attended Yale School of Fine Arts, BFA, studied with Josef Albers

1958-59 Fulbright Fellowship to Florence and Rome

TEACHING EXPERIENCE

1966 University of California, Davis

1967-69 School of Visual Arts, New York

1969 University of California, Berkeley, Summer

1969-74 California State University at Sacramento

He lives with his wife, Lannis Raffael in the south of France.
